Output 51dd369299ec5e24de005f1f83481edc6209fdfaec71edfcdfcca1b3f2e76585:0

value
580397
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55951f6f2768453c3a2b988719307292c163ace8 OP_EQUALVERIFY OP_CHECKSIG
address
18oX5YF5TDvBPsUvCMJmU93TKgzzB1xycs
transaction
51dd369299ec5e24de005f1f83481edc6209fdfaec71edfcdfcca1b3f2e76585
spent
true